Retired from Rutland Hospital in Vermont, neurologist Margaret Waddington turned her skills to writing, photography, and sketching, at her restored Vermont farmhouse. She published many other children's books, essays, memoirs, and seasonal photo essay books. Fine. Signed by author. Inscribed by author. 1.

Autobiographical, 2-generation short book begun by Gladys Olcutt, and completed and published posthumously by her daughter, Margaret Waddington who described this volume, "like an unfinished symphony". The women had shared a home in Vermont for 10 years "in friendship, love and mutual respect" when Olcutt succumbed at age 74. 1.
